Piazza del Campidoglio

Piazza del Campidoglio Designed by Michelangelo himself, this elegant hilltop square is home to the Capitoline Museums and offers sweeping views over the Roman Forum. A perfect place to reflect on the layers of Rome’s political and cultural history.

9

Temple of Hercules Victor

Temple of Hercules Victor This circular marble temple near the Tiber River is the oldest surviving building in Rome made entirely of marble. Often mistaken for a Roman temple of Vesta, it’s a rare example of Greek influence in Roman architecture.

10

Temple of Portunus

Temple of Portunus Next to the Temple of Hercules, this small, elegant structure dedicated to the god of harbors is one of the best-preserved temples from ancient Rome, showcasing classical harmony and proportion.

11

Theatre of Marcellus

Theatre of Marcellus Often called the “mini Colosseum,” this ancient theater pre-dates the Flavian amphitheater and once hosted drama, music, and poetry. Its massive arches still support modern apartments — a true blend of past and present.

Pantheon

Pantheon Marvel at this architectural wonder, with its immense dome and oculus still inspiring awe after nearly 2,000 years. Once a temple to all gods, it is now a church and a resting place for Italian kings and Raphael.
